One of the most significant grounds for the immense interest in online poker is its availability. People can log on to their favorite internet poker platforms whenever you want, from everywhere, utilizing their computers or mobile devices. This convenience has actually attracted a diverse player base, which range from leisure players to professionals, leading to the quick growth of online poker.

Advantages of Internet Poker:
On-line poker provides a few advantages over conventional br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ises. Firstly, it gives a larger selection of game choices, including different poker variants and stakes, providing to your preferences and budgets of all of the kinds of players. Furthermore, on-line poker areas are available 24/7, getting rid of the limitations of physical casino working hours. Furthermore, web platforms frequently provide attractive incentives, respect programs, and also the power to play numerous tables simultaneously, improving the overall gaming experience.

Challenges and Regulation:
Whilst the internet poker business thrives, it deals with challenges in the form of legislation and protection issues. Governments globally have actually implemented differing levels of regulation to safeguard players and give a wide berth to fraudulent activities. In addition, online poker systems need sturdy safety actions to guard players' individual and financial information, making sure a secure playing environment.

Economic and Personal Influence:
The rise of online poker has already established a substantial economic effect globally. Online poker platforms produce considerable income through rake charges, competition entry costs, and advertising. This revenue has led to job creation and opportunities when you look at the video gaming industry. Additionally, internet poker has contributed to an increase in income tax income for governing bodies where its regulated, promoting community solutions.

From a social viewpoint, internet poker has actually fostered a global poker community, bridging geographical obstacles. Players from diverse experiences and places can connect and contend, fostering a sense of camaraderie. Internet poker has additionally played a vital role to promote the game's appeal and attracting brand new people, causing the expansion of poker industry in general.
